This is Kaylah Lynn.

She is an 18 years-old girl from Seattle, Washington who aspires to become a famous singer. But her fans are like no other.

Lynn said that at one point in August a raccoon that she decided to call Rosemary began visiting her house. But after a few visits, the little raccoon disappeared for a time.

But when Rosemary finally returned she came back with her whole family. Who began to visit her every night at 7:30 pm sharp. Pretty formal for a raccoon, probably more than many people you might know.

Lynn recently decided to tell a friend about her visiting raccoons. And the friend finds it so awesome and adorable that decided to tweet it. Since then, Tuesday, the tweet has been liked over 35,000 times.

Lynn said that the raccoons now form part of her daily life, as they have got into a routine with her and know when to show up for dinner. As she acts like her owner/mom as she takes care of every one of the 5 furry guys. “They all have their own little personalities so I can tell who is who,” she said. “Also, I can tell who is who by their facial structures.”

Kaylah also has turned into a raccoon defendant. As she said “I feel raccoons get stereotyped a lot ‘cause they get in people’s garbages. But they have hearts and love too, just like humans.” As all animals deserve love.
